titleOfInvention | Method for efficiently removing microparticles from water |
abstract | The invention discloses a method for efficiently removing microparticles from water. The method comprises the following steps of: pre-filtration, flocculation, and secondary filtration, wherein filter materials adopted in the pre-filtration and secondary filtration are hydrophobic polypropylene fibers which have the average diameter of 48-58mu m, the filament tensile strength of 117-215MPa and the porosity of 97.57-98.27 percent. The treatment method is simple, conditions are mild, and the turbidity removal ratio for a microparticle-containing water sample with the initial turbidity of 77-354NTU is over 98 percent; and moreover, the hydrophobic polypropylene fiber filter packing is light in weight and easy to mount, the manufacturing, mounting, using and maintenance cost of filter equipment in actual application are reduced, and the method is easy to promote and use. |
